Multiplicative Inverse of 1543

Multiplicative Inverse of 1543 is defined as what you can multiply with 1543 to get 1.
If the Multiplicative Inverse of 1543 is x, the problem can be written as a function as follows:
1543(x) = 1
Thus, to get the answer, we divide 1 by 1543 like this:
1 / 1543 = 0.00064809
Note that the answer is rounded to the nearest 8 decimals if necessary. We can prove that the answer is correct: 0.00064809 multiplied by 1543 equals 1.
The Multiplicative Inverse of postive 1543 has a positive answer and the Multiplicative Inverse of negative 1543 has a negative answer. Therefore, the Multiplicative Inverse of -1543 is -0.00064809.
